About D. He
D. He is a scholar working on Ocean Engineering, Biomedical Engineering, Organic Chemistry, Discrete Mathematics and Combinatorics and Geometry and Topology, having authored 7 papers that have together received 46 indexed citations. Recurring topics across this work include Phase Equilibria and Thermodynamics (2 papers), ZnO doping and properties (1 paper), Cyclopropane Reaction Mechanisms (1 paper), Drilling and Well Engineering (1 paper), Dark Matter and Cosmic Phenomena (1 paper), Graph Labeling and Dimension Problems (1 paper), Atomic and Subatomic Physics Research (1 paper) and Graph theory and applications (1 paper). The work is most often cited by research in Nuclear and High Energy Physics (8 citations), Radiation (5 citations), Atomic and Molecular Physics, and Optics (18 citations), Electrical and Electronic Engineering (20 citations) and Statistical and Nonlinear Physics (4 citations). D. He has collaborated with scholars based in China, Germany and United States. Frequent co-authors include Qiancheng Zhou, Xing Zhou, Xiao Han, Xiaobo Hu, R. L. Cooper, Hongyang Wang, F. E. Wietfeldt, A. K. Thompson, J. Byrne and J. S. Nico. Their work appears in journals such as Molecules, Journal of Chemical & Engineering Data, Energy & Environmental Science, Physical Review Letters and Chemical Engineering Science.
